exsertion Definition
- 1the act of thrusting out or protruding
- 2the state of being thrust out or protruded

Summary: exsertion in Brief
The term 'exsertion' [ɪkˈsəːʃ(ə)n] refers to the act of thrusting out or protruding, or the state of being thrust out or protruded.
